The error message described in IMPALA-6442 incorrectly reported the file offset where the Parquet footer starts, as if the offset is counted from the file end instead of from the file beginning. The fix changed the reported file offset to be counted from the beginning of the Parquet file. Testing: Create a small table that contains one row of data with a single column that's bigint and store it as Parquet. Manually changed the footer size field to be 1) smaller than the original footer size by 1, to trigger the error message fixed by this jira to be printed, to verify that the fix functions correctly; 2) bigger than the file size, thus to trigger another related error message to be printed. bad_rle_literal_count.parquet:
|
|
Generated by hacking Impala's Parquet writer.
|
|
Contains a single bigint column 'c' with the values 1, 3, 7 stored
|
|
in a single data chunk as dictionary plain. The RLE encoded dictionary
|
|
indexes are all literals (and not repeated), but the literal count
|
|
is incorrectly 0 in the file to test that such data corruption is
|
|
proprly handled.
|
|
|
|
bad_rle_repeat_count.parquet:
|
|
Generated by hacking Impala's Parquet writer.
|
|
Contains a single bigint column 'c' with the value 7 repeated 7 times
|
|
stored in a single data chunk as dictionary plain. The RLE encoded dictionary
|
|
indexes are a single repeated run (and not literals), but the repeat count
|
|
is incorrectly 0 in the file to test that such data corruption is proprly
|
|
handled.

alltypes_agg_bitpacked_def_levels.parquet:
|
|
Generated by hacking Impala's Parquet writer to write out bitpacked def levels instead
|
|
of the standard RLE-encoded levels. See
|
|
https://github.com/timarmstrong/incubator-impala/tree/hack-bit-packed-levels. This
|
|
is a single file containing all of the alltypesagg data, which includes a mix of
|
|
null and non-null values. This is not actually a valid Parquet file because the
|
|
bit-packed levels are written in the reverse order specified in the Parquet spec
|
|
for BIT_PACKED. However, this is the order that Impala attempts to read the levels
|
|
in - see IMPALA-3006.

corrupt_footer_len_decr.parquet:
|
|
Parquet file that contains one row of the following schema:
|
|
- bigint c
|
|
The footer size is manually modified (using hexedit) to be the original file size minus
|
|
1, to cause metadata deserialization in footer parsing to fail, thus trigger the printing
|
|
of an error message with incorrect file offset, to verify that it's fixed by IMPALA-6442.
|
|
|
|
corrupt_footer_len_incr.parquet:
|
|
Parquet file that contains one row of the following schema:
|
|
- bigint c
|
|
The footer size is manually modified (using hexedit) to be larger than the original file
|
|
size and cause footer parsing to fail. It's used to test an error message related to
|
|
IMPALA-6442.
